The K&N air filter probably doesn't get you even one extra HP in reality because the 2.5i is not limited by air restriction from the factory. Basically it's just a better air cleaner, but it will prevent power LOSS from a dirty stock air cleaner. I just helped my Mom buy a 2011 Forester Limited.. it has the 4 speed auto. It's not too bad but the 5-speed is definitely the sportier option. Enjoy your Impreza, it's a great car.

Hi badb0ysparkz, Yeah winter is home for Subarus. I love driving it in the snow. There's a nice little trick that Subaru put in your Impreza for extra power when AC is running. It's in your owners manual. If you want full power with AC ON, Floor the gas pedal. The AC will automatically shut off temporarily to give you full power. It works- I tried it a few times, and it helps on hot days making a pass on the highway or using an up-hill on-ramp.

Mine has a 16.9 gal tank. I've averaged 28+ mgp over last 4600 mi. My 5 speed manual has plenty of power.. it is a 2009 California model which happens to have 175hp for some reason and because it's a sedan manual trans it only weighs 3016 lbs., while imprezas with auto trans weigh as much as 3360lbs which is a big difference when pushed by 170hp or so. It is not a fast car by any stretch, but it isn't slow either. It gets from 50 mph to 80 pretty quickly in 4th gear for example.
